How much is fine for failure to provide common firefighting equipment on motor vehicles in Vietnam?
Pursuant to Clause 2, Article 44 of Decree 144/2021/ND-CP stipulating violations against regulations on provision, storage and use of fire safety and firefighting equipment as follows:
2. A fine ranging from 500.000 VND to 1.500.000 VND shall be imposed for any of the following violations:
a) Failure to periodically inspect and maintain the fire safety and firefighting equipment and system;
b) Failure to preserve personal protective equipment and extinguishing agent as prescribed by law;
c) Failure to have adequate or compatible fire safety and firefighting equipment as prescribed by law;
d) Failure to provide common firefighting equipment on motor vehicles as prescribed by law;
dd) Losing, damaging or compromising common firefighting equipment, extinguishing agents, firefighting communication devices.
Thus, failure to provide common firefighting equipment on motor vehicles in Vietnam will result in a fine ranging from VND 500,000 to VND 1,500,000.
What are penalties for failure to provide common firefighting equipment in houses, buildings or on motor vehicles that have special fire safety requirements for passenger transport in Vietnam?
Pursuant to Clause 4, Article 44 of Decree 144/2021/ND-CP stipulating violations against regulations on provision, storage and use of fire safety and firefighting equipment as follows:
4. A fine ranging from 5.000.000 VND to 10.000.000 VND shall be imposed for any of the following violations:
a) Failure to provide common firefighting equipment in houses, buildings or on motor vehicles that have special fire safety requirements for passenger transport as prescribed by law;
b) Losing, damaging or compromising firefighting apparatus, fire alarm or firefighting system;
c) Failure to maintain the readiness of the available firefighting apparatus, fire alarm or firefighting system as prescribed by law;
d) Falsifying the certificate of inspection of fire safety and firefighting equipment.
Thus, failure to provide common firefighting equipment in houses, buildings or on motor vehicles that have special fire safety requirements for passenger transport in Vietnam will be fined from 5,000,000 VND to 10,000,000 VND.
